DooK
本帖最后由 DooK 于 2023-1-24 21:19 编辑

版本为1.16.5这是目前做的自定义机器界面,现在遇到的问题是。
造石机:两个流体槽,如果注入水两个槽都会装满水,无法注入其他液体(需要限制槽位只允许某些液体的输入)


聚爆压缩机:四个输入槽,TNT只能在指定槽位参与制作,但是管道输入会跑到其他槽位导致自动化卡住(限制指定物品槽位只允许物品输入,设置槽位黑名单)


模组wiki链接(只会机翻没找到相关教程,不知道有没有实现方式):
https://github.com/Frinn38/Custom-Machinery/wiki

无敌三脚猫
只能装水的液体槽
  1. {
  2.     "type": "custommachinery:fluid",
  3.     "capacity": 10000,
  4.     "id": "watertank",
  5.     "maxInput": 1000,
  6.     "maxOutput": 0,
  7.     "mode": "input",
  8.     "filter": ["minecraft:water"],
  9.     "whitelist": true
  10. }
复制代码
设置黑名单的物品槽
  1. {
  2.     "type": "custommachinery:item",
  3.     "id": "tnt",
  4.     "filter": ["随便写点什么"],
  5.     "mode": "input",
  6. }
复制代码
但是,为什么是黑名单,你想让这个槽只能装tnt,那不应该是白名单吗?

DooK
无敌三脚猫 发表于 2023-1-24 23:03
只能装水的液体槽设置黑名单的物品槽但是,为什么是黑名单,你想让这个槽只能装tnt,那不应该是白名单吗? ...

白名单让TNT只能进入这个槽位,黑名单防止TNT跑到其他槽位(白名单咋写嘞)

无敌三脚猫
DooK 发表于 2023-1-24 23:51
白名单让TNT只能进入这个槽位,黑名单防止TNT跑到其他槽位(白名单咋写嘞) ...

写在"filter"里的就是黑名单
"filter"和"whitelist": true一起写,就是白名单

第一页 上一页 下一页 最后一页